When I switch on my livewell pump, the water rushes in and then gets drained out. It never gets above an inch or two of water. So my instinct tells me that I should fill it with water, then turn on the pump to maintain the full well of circulating water. Is that correct? Als, should I keep the pump running while I have fish in there or should I switch it on periodically?

Depends on the type of livewell. Is there a little rubber donut in the bottom? if so you should have a tube that plugs into that that will let the water drain when it gets to the top of the tube....

The livewell pump won't draw water while the boat's under way, so turn it off. Otherwise its a good idea to run it while you have fish in there. I usually run mine off & on throughout the day, hot days I leave it on most all the time - in the winter not so much. Cold water holds more oxygen. Or, on/off timers are available for intermittent operation.
